Are you planning your web hosting
needs for 2007? Maybe you are ready
to buy a web hosting
plan for a new blog site?
Then it's a great time for you or
your company to consider the
following tips for a successful year
of hosting! By following these
simple steps, you can not only save
money, but also ensure that your
website has its most successful year
ever.
Tip #1: Upgrade to an Annual
Plan - If you are happy with your
hosting provider, consider moving to
an annual payment basis. By doing
this, you can benefit from a lower
prorated monthly rate. If you are
looking to transfer to a new web
host in January, you might also wish
to consider an annual plan as they
often come with
no set-up fee.
Tip #2: The economy is
growing and Internet users are
rising. Is your company website
ready for an increase in traffic
during 2007? With monthly fees for
dedicated servers coming down
rapidly over the past year, your
business may wish to consider moving
to a dedicated environment which
will offer more capacity for
servicing your online customers. At
least be sure that your current plan
has
adequate bandwidth allowances.
Tip #3: Check out your
Hosting Service Agreements. These
agreements contain the "legal terms"
of your hosting contract and may be
changed from time to time. The 'New
Year' is a good time to review the
latest documents surrounding the
relationship between you and your
web host.
Tip #4: Secure a support
domain for your company. Many
companies are now providing
technical support and service
follow-up online. With Internet
access still growing on a worldwide
basis, you may wish to consider
reserving the domain name for a
potential service/support site. For
example, usxmodeltrains.com might
wish to reserve usxtrainsupport.com.
Also, think about registering some
of the new top levels domains
including .info and .biz - these can
be useful in driving more traffic to
your website.
Tip #5: Watch for software
upgrades! Each year, many providers
of web design and server software
launch new versions. Make sure your
company is using the latest design
software to maximize your site
visitor's experiences. Also, by
checking to see if your provider has
the latest server versions, you can
verify their technical knowledge and
ensure maximum website uptime.
By following these simple tips, your
business can maximize it's online
efforts in 2006 by ensuring a stable
hosting environment while gaining
better knowledge about your web
host.
